Address

D82W5hfMmRRrcxV3jEbrfx6Wy3Z4doDBbN

0 DGB

Confirmed
Total Received 100.04480446 DGB20.58 TWD
Total Sent 100.04480446 DGB20.58 TWD
Final Balance 0 DGB0.00 TWD
No. Transactions 2

Transactions

D82W5hfMmRRrcxV3jEbrfx6Wy3Z4doDBbN 100.04480446 DGB20.58 TWD20.58 TWD
 
D5VjNkCHh4qEx6W4tQQB7rZeWNREvPGo55 0.22605247 DGB0.05 TWD0.05 TWD
DCgiFxSzVheJZPizoJDdzLJMbkoexBJu57 99.81852599 DGB20.53 TWD20.53 TWD
DLhNH7vaGKjudfoH95uQEr9ZvejqK9zWfZ 201.25413744 DGB41.40 TWD41.40 TWD
 
D82W5hfMmRRrcxV3jEbrfx6Wy3Z4doDBbN 100.04480446 DGB20.58 TWD20.58 TWD
D6PSLkxR5q32jC6PvjxDfY1X19ib4TpVUe 101.20910698 DGB20.82 TWD20.82 TWD